2.8.24 PROGRAM MIRROR IMAGE (G 68, G 69~
Program
mirror image is the feature to reverse
the NC program operation in all directions
around the work center line (Z-axis) by the use
of G command.

G68; . . .
G69; “-”
Program mirror image on.
The program mirror image on
state is held until G 69 is speci–
fied.
Program mirror image off.
The program mirror image off
state is held until G68 is speci–
fied.
When program mirror image is on, the X-
axis operation by the NC program IS in-
verted with Z-axis being the center line.
The manual operations (manual continuous
feed and handle /step feed) are not affected
by this feature.
Details of program mirror image
When the PROGRAM mirror image feature is
on, the movement by the NC program is
inverted with Z-axis ‘being the center line.
The following inversion is processed in the
NC unit:
X command for X-axis coordinate value is
inverted.
U command for X-axis incremental coordinate
value is inverted.
I command for x -axis coordinate value of
arc center is inverted.
Circular motion direction inverted.

I command for X-axis beveling/rounding
volume and direction is inverted.
I command for canned cycle taper X–axis
distance is inverted.
U and I commands for special canned cycles
finishing allowance, etc. are inverted.
h. The operational direction after X-axis tool
position compensation is inverted.
i. T command for tool nose radius compensa–
tion tool nose center is inverted in the sign.
